## Configuration

So you want to build a plugin for Tankard, our fleet fuel-usage reporter? Nice. Plugins get read access to the aggregated burn-rate tables, which means you'll want a local config before anything renders. Copy `.env.sample` to `.env`, set `TANKARD_REGION` to whatever depot cluster you're testing against (we use `westvale` internally), and pick a report window — weekly is the sane default. Your plugin also needs to authenticate against the Tankard reporting API. Put this line in your .env:

sealed setting: LEDGER_TOKEN13=5d842615a26d7

## Runbook: Lanternshelf Catalogue Import — Restart Procedure

If the nightly Lanternshelf import stalls, stop the worker, clear the staging table, and rerun from the last committed checkpoint. Never rerun from zero during open hours; it locks the catalogue. Verify row counts against the source manifest before marking complete. The importer reads all tunables at startup from the values listed below.

deployment values, tafog-kagap:
wenath:
  pin: 4244
  metrics_host: metrics.wenath.lumicsys.internal
  tenant: istix
  seal: seal_10585894

Handover: log sampling for Brayvault ingest

Brayvault's ingest service is chatty — we sample at 1:50 in prod, 1:5 in staging. Support: if a customer reports missing log lines, check the sampling tier first before escalating. Error-level lines are never dropped. Toggling rates requires a config push, not a restart. Procedure and current rates are on the internal page.

dashboard of bafof-hafog = https://confluence.lumiclabs.internal/display/browse/display/6a09a20a

## Hunting leaked file descriptors

The Quillbox ingest service occasionally exhausts its descriptor limit after long uploads. When paged, first check the per-process fd count on the affected node and compare against the baseline dashboard. Most leaks trace back to the thumbnail worker, which opens temp files without a finally block on error paths. Restarting buys time but doesn't fix it; capture an lsof snapshot first and attach it to the incident. Historical fd counts live in the telemetry database, reachable via the connection below.

primary connection of baweg-kahop = mysql://eliox_svc:Z0@db-4ab3.urlaqstack.local:5432/oliok